Formaldehyde condensations with phenol and its homologues. V. The methylol compounds of 3 : 5-dimethylphenol

Abstract
The structure of the monoalcohol of 3 : 5‐dimethylphenol, first made by von Auwers and believed to be a para‐substituted derivative, has now been confirmed. The synthesis of a new dialcohol, which has been characterized as an ortho‐ortho compound, is described. The effect of reaction conditions on the position of methylol substitution is discussed. It has been shown that during characterization of the monoalcohol, by pyrolysis with lime, methyl migration may occur.
